Paolo Bonzini 8d2aec3b2d KVM: x86: use u64_to_user_ptr()
There is no danger to the kernel if 32-bit userspace provides a 64-bit
value that has the high bits set, but for whatever reason happens to
resolve to an address that has something mapped there.  KVM uses the
checked version of get_user() and put_user(), so any faults are caught
properly.
